Urma Population - Pithoragarh, Uttarakhand
Urma is a medium size village located in Didihat Tehsil of Pithoragarh district, Uttarakhand with total 63 families residing. The Urma village has population of 266 of which 115 are males while 151 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Urma village population of children with age 0-6 is 29 which makes up 10.90 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Urma village is 1313 which is higher than Uttarakhand state average of 963. Child Sex Ratio for the Urma as per census is 706, lower than Uttarakhand average of 890.
Urma village has lower literacy rate compared to Uttarakhand. In 2011, literacy rate of Urma village was 70.89 % compared to 78.82 % of Uttarakhand. In Urma Male literacy stands at 83.67 % while female literacy rate was 61.87 %.

Urma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 63 | - | - |
Population | 266 | 115 | 151 |
Child (0-6) | 29 | 17 | 12 |
Schedule Caste | 66 | 30 | 36 |
Schedule Tribe | 0 | 0 | 0 |
Literacy | 70.89 % | 83.67 % | 61.87 % |
Total Workers | 100 | 43 | 57 |
Main Worker | 80 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 20 | 18 | 2 |
